One of the simplest and most effective ways to use dry fruits in decoration is to create stunning centerpieces. A bowl filled with colorful dry fruits like apricots, figs, and dates can be placed on your dining table or coffee table, making a vibrant statement. You can also mix them with nuts or add some decorative stones for an interesting texture. Another fantastic idea is to use dry fruits in wreaths or garlands. By stringing together dried oranges, apples, or cranberries, you can create a festive garland perfect for holidays or seasonal decor. These natural decorations bring a cozy, rustic feel to your home and can be easily customized to match your color scheme. For a more elaborate project, consider making wall art with dry fruits. You can create beautiful patterns or designs by gluing dry fruits onto a canvas. This not only adds a unique element to your wall but also allows you to express your creativity. Plus, the natural colors of the fruits can harmonize beautifully with any room’s decor. If you're looking for a great way to enhance your kitchen decor, consider hanging bunches of dried fruits. Bundles of dried chilies, garlic, or fruit can add color and a rustic charm to your kitchen space. They also serve a practical purpose, as some dried fruits can be used in cooking or baking. Finally, don’t forget about the seasonal opportunities to use dry fruits in your decoration. During autumn, you can create stunning displays with dried corn, pumpkins, and apples. For winter, think about incorporating dried fruits into your holiday decorations, such as ornaments or table settings.
